Recently finished this aluminum bladed single handed sword with an S-curve guard, wheel pommel and spiral carved wire wrapped grip. The pommel is secured with a recessed 1/4”-28 allen nut. I got a lot of positive feedback on the last wire wrap I posted, so I thought I'd get a little fancier with this one. The grip is carved poplar wrapped with steel and brass wire. Very comfy in the hand.
Because the pommel is relatively small and the blade is un-fullered, this handles more like a steel sword of similar proportions. Its light and quick, but with a more "realistic" blade presence than most of my aluminum swords. The PoB is 3.75” above the guard.
Blade: 31”
Total Length: 37”
